先週末に,ひょんなことから scratch-log.el という emacs の拡張をつくってみました。この記事は,scratch-log.el の紹介です。scratch-log.el は,3つの機能を提供します。 スクラッチバッファに書いた内容のログをとります スクラッチバッファを削除できなくします(オプション) emacs 起動時に,最後に終了したときの スクラッチバッファの内容を復元します(オプション) スクラッチバッファとは,emacs 起動時に表示される "*scratch*" という名前のバッファです。一時的なメモや,人によっては elisp の試し書きなどで便利に使われています。しかし,このバッファはどのファイルとも紐づいていないこともあり,誤操作で C-k を押し内容を失って痛い思いをすることがあります。その対策として,scratch-log.el を書きました。ログは1
はじめに MacBookと暮らし初めてひと月半ほど経ちました. Macでは,テキストエディタとして Carbon Emacs (以下,emacs)を使っています.それまで使ってきた(現在もときどき使ってますが) xyzzy との微妙な差異に最初は多少悩まされましたが,ここ最近で,ようやく慣れてきた感があります. その間,自分が使いやすいようにと,先人の記録を参考に,emcas 設定を追加・変更してきました. 以下,そんな設定の現状についてメモ的にまとめてみました.特に目新しいものなどはありませんが. 設定の前に *.el を置く場所 拡張する際,先人が書かれた emacs lisp ファイルを特定の場所に置く必要が出ることがありますが,その場所がまったくわからなかったので,参考にさせていただいたものが以下. また、MacOSXでメジャーなCarbon Emacsのsite-lispディレク
Here are Emacs definitions that let you display line numbers to the left of buffers (screen-shot). Download either: linum.el for Emacs >=22, or linum.el for older Emacs versions and XEmacs Copy the appropriate linum.el to your load-path and add to your .emacs: (require 'linum) Then toggle display of line numbers with M-x linum-mode. Main page
More Emacs Plugin is an eclipse plugin for emacs users. Eclipse provides the emacs like key bindings. But emacs users require more emacs like key bindings. More emacs plugin provides more emacs like key bindings. The key bind scheme of more emacs is a child schema of Eclispe's emacs scheme. It adds some key bindings or overrides some bindings to emacs scheme. Install You can install the plugin by
秀丸は言わずとしれた有名エディタで、開発業務を行っている人にとってなくてはならないアプリです(若干の誇張有り)。強力かつ高速な編集機能、かゆいところに手が届く機能、などなど。 これがなければ皆の生産性は半分以下に落ちてしまうと思います(若干の誇張有り)。使いこなせば使いこなすほど馴染んでくる、というカスタマイズ性の高さも素晴らしい。 その辺はおあつらえのIDEじゃ味わえないです。もうね、開発者だったらどんなことがあっても入れて使いこなせるようになっておくべき、とも思うくらい。 バージョンが上がるごとに「この機能がほしかった」というツボな機能が入ってくるところもね。開発者のことを大切にしてくれているな、という気持ちにさせてくれる「分かっている」アプリなのです。
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く